Key Responsibilities

  • •Design, build, and maintain integrations with EMR/EHR platforms across API-based and legacy systems.
  • •Internalize and replace third-party integration dependencies where appropriate.
  • •Develop scalable, secure, and reliable healthcare data pipelines.
  • •Build data validation, transformation, and normalization layers across heterogeneous healthcare systems.
  • •Monitor integration health, troubleshoot production issues, and implement observability best practices while partnering with product, clinical, and AI teams.
